Kaufland has invested more than 338 million euros in Romania since it entered in October 2005. The company announced it would invest almost 130 million euros this year to open 16 more hypermarkets. The retailer plans to open approximately 50 outlets mainly in small and medium sized cities.

Last year the company initiated a 300 million-euro project in partnership with the European Bank of Reconstruction and Development (EBRD) to “contribute to increase the competition mostly in secondary cities and relatively disadvantaged areas,” the EBRD project summary shows.

Kaufland is a part of Lidl&Schwarz Co&KG, founded in 1930. The group has over 166,000 employees working in its 800 hypermarkets in seven European countries. Last year, the group posted revenues from sales totaling 40 billion euros.
